Ingredients

Gather the following ingredients to make this delicious cake:

For the Cake

  • 1 ¾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• ¾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• ½ tsp baking soda
  • ½ tsp salt
  • 1 cup finely chopped hazelnuts

For the Frosting

  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 8 oz dark chocolate, chopped
  • 2 tbsp powdered sugar
  • ½ cup crushed hazelnuts for garnish

Make sure to measure your ingredients accurately for the best results!

Instructions

Follow these steps to create your Capricorn Chocolate Hazelnut Cake:

Prepare the Cake Batter

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a large mixing bowl, beat the butter and sugar together until creamy. Add the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la extract.

In another bowl, combine the fl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, mixing until just combined. Fold in the chopped hazelnuts.

Bake the Cake

Pour the batter into a greased 9-inch round cake pan.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Allow the cake to c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ely.

Make the Frosting

In a small saucepan, heat the heavy cream until just simmering. Remove from heat and add the chopped dark chocolate. Let it sit for a minute, then stir until smooth. Stir in powdered sugar.

Allow the frosting to cool until it thickens slightly.

Assemble the Cake

Once the cake is completely cool, spread the chocolate frosting evenly over the top and sides of the cake. Garnish with crushed hazelnuts.

Slice the cake and serve it with your favorite beverage!

Tips for the Perfect Bake

To ensure your Capricorn Chocolate Hazelnut Cake comes out perfectly every time, consider using room temperature ingredients. This helps achieve a smooth batter and a consistent bake. If you forget to take your butter and eggs out in advance, a quick 10-second blast in the microwave for the butter can help, but be careful not to melt it completely.

Another important tip is to accurately measure your dry ingredients. Using a kitchen scale can help achieve precision, especially with flour and cocoa powder. This attention to detail will result in a cake that rises beautifully and has the perfect texture.

Storing Your Cake

If you’re lucky enough to have leftovers, storing your Capricorn Chocolate Hazelnut Cake properly is essential to maintain its moistness and flavor. Keep the cake in an airtight container at room temperature for up to three days. If you want to keep it longer, consider refrigerating it, but make sure to allow it to come to room temperature before serving to enjoy the best texture and taste.

For longer storage, this cake can also be frozen. Wrap it tightly in plastic wrap and then in aluminum foil to prevent freezer burn. When you’re ready to enjoy, simply let it thaw in the fridge overnight, and then bring it back to room temperature before serving.

Variations to Try

While the Capricorn Chocolate Hazelnut Cake is delightful as is, don’t hesitate to experiment with flavors. You can add a hint of espresso powder to the cake batter for an enhanced chocolate flavor or try incorporating orange zest for a citrus twist that complements the hazelnuts beautifully.

For the frosting, consider using a ganache made with milk chocolate for a sweeter finish, or add a splash of liqueur, such as Frangelico, to the frosting for an adult twist. These variations can make the cake your own while maintaining the rich, decadent base that everyone loves.

Questions About Recipes

→ Can I use different nuts?

Yes, you can substitute hazelnuts with walnuts or almonds if desired.

→ How should I store the cake?

Store the cake in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days.

→ Can I make this cake 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can bake the cake a day in advance and frost it the day you plan to serve it.

→ Is this recipe suitable for gluten-free diets?

You can use a gluten-free flour blend to make this cake gluten-free.
